Rehearing denied March 19, 1951. Suit was filed in the circuit court of Ford County by the New York, Chicago and St. Louis Railroad Company against the American Transit Lines, Inc. A trial before a jury resulted in a verdict for the plaintiff in the sum of $17,800. After the verdict was returned, plaintiff filed a motion for judgment in its favor against the defendant for the amount of $51,242.22, notwithstanding the verdict of the jury in favor of plaintiff for the above amount. An alternative motion for a new trial was also filed by plaintiff. Both motions were overruled. A countermotion was filed by the defendant, asking the court to reduce the verdict by crediting thereon the sum of $2000, which plaintiff had received from two other defendants to whom it had given a covenant not to sue. This motion was allowed and judgment entered on the verdict in the sum of $15,800. The plaintiff appealed to the Appellate Court, where the judgment was affirmed. No cross appeal was taken by appellee. The cause is now in this court, leave to appeal having been allowed.
